Packed With Love-Vision

As I gaze at my gorgeous lunch salad sings to me a sonorous love ballad! What’s dazzling about temporal food that calls for this surreal mood? The melting silk of shredded cheese, the sharp crunch of leafy lettuce, the crimson of tomatoes. All hold a spot arcane tucked behind the corridors mundane, oft murmurous with banal ‘I-love-you’, jewels, roses and boxed rocks so blue. The quiet gesture of you packing my meal with thoughtfulness and honest zeal makes my heart quiver with glee. Your love sprinkled in the foliage medley don’t know if any eye can see.
